FIRST 100 DAYS by Kevin Siers, CagleCartoons.com
Kevin Siers captures Donald Trump in a classic meme setup, seated at a table with a mug as fire engulfs the room, a king crown atop his head, uttering \'This is beautiful.\' The tags include tariffs, border, polls, the press, judges, and references to the KC Green \'This is fine\' meme. This political cartoon from 2025 highlights a satirical take on the president\'s first 100 days, showing him oblivious to surrounding destruction. The dry humor underscores denial amid crisis, with the crown symbolizing monarchical pretensions. Apologies to KC Green nod to the original work, blending current events like polls and the press into a visually striking commentary.

Trump's Tariff Wall: Who's Really Paying the Price?
BUILD THAT TARIFF WALL by John Darkow, politicalcartoons.com
The cartoon shows a blond-haired man atop a stone wall marked 'TARIFFS,' shouting 'Build that wall! And who is gonna pay for it!' A red-hatted figure in a 'MAGA' shirt below responds 'Most definitely we are!' This setup draws a parallel to familiar chants, underscoring tariffs as a burden on consumers. Tags like Trump, tariffs, build the wall, MAGA, inflation, economy, trade war, backfire, and recession frame the scene. The dry humor lies in the obvious irony, where supporters unwittingly acknowledge the cost. Composition keeps it simple, with grassy base and bold lettering for impact. Such cartoons thrive on timely policy jabs, making this one sharable amid ongoing trade debates.

DOGE figure looms with chainsaws as elderly brace for Social Security cuts
FIRST DOGE CAME by Christopher Weyant, politicalcartoons.com
The cartoon depicts a massive DOGE figure wielding chainsaws while two seniors labeled Social and Security express concern on a sidewalk. Text on the wall recites an updated version of the 'First they came' poem listing USAID, FBI, NOAA, FEMA and the Department of Education. The seniors reply that a nice man promised to care for them. The image responds to 2025 efforts by the Department of Government Efficiency to reduce federal agencies and spending.
